I was thinking on my walk this morning about Bobby and his weight problem.Many months ago a friend was telling me about a good eatting program they were using in the school systems with young children.
Basically it envolves teaching kids about good foods versus bad foods.
Good foods get a green light and foods you have to be careful about get a yellow lght and foods high in sugar and fat get a red light.
